Abstract
With the continuous development of in‐car display applications, the demand for in‐car glasses‐free 3D display screens is gradually increasing. This article adopts a high‐resolution 4K display screen based on prism technology, and is equipped with a human eye tracking system implemented using a regular monocular camera. This configuration enables the in‐car instrument display to provide a high‐quality glasses‐free 3D display effect within a large visual range, addressing the limited viewing area issue associated with traditional glasses‐free 3D displays. Due to constraints in camera hardware conditions, we introduced a motion compensation and motion prediction algorithm. Through experimental validation, this algorithm significantly enhances the performance of human eye tracking using a regular camera. A comparison with traditional eye‐tracking methods demonstrates the substantial advantages of this algorithm in improving the performance of in‐car 3D display technology.
